Robert J. Gillies, PhD

Research Interests:

Dr. Gillies' current research projects are focused on the use of non-invasive imaging for cancer therapy and are divided into three interrelated areas; (1) The interrogation and modeling of the tumor microenvironment and its effect on tumor progression and therapy; (2) Development of multivalent targeting molecules for specific cancer imaging and delivery of therapy; (3) The use of imaging as a biomarker of therapy response.
